Purpose To determine how physicians management decisions are affected by the results of brain CT perfusion (CTP) imaging.Materials and Methods From August, 2014 to March, 2016, 43 in-patients with neurological symptoms were randomly selected from neurology ward.All of these patients performed whole brain CTP on a multi-slice CT (GE HD750).Two radiologists read the CTP images.31 patients who received neurological treatment were included in this study.Treatment data was collected on electronic patient record system by an experienced resident working in neurology department.Primary measures were drug dose amount, including drugs for antiplatelet, neurothophy, improving microcirculation and enhancing cerebral function.Secondary measures addressed alternative diagnosis or treatment.During treatment, neurologists and radiologists were double-blinded.The drug dose amount between pre- and post-CTP was compared.Regression analysis was used to identify association between measures and CTP.
